- [RKE2 Standalone Disaster Recovery Guide](https://support.tools/post/rke2-standalone-disaster-recovery/) 🌟 - A comprehensive guide to recovering standalone RKE2 clusters not managed by Rancher, covering scenarios like etcd quorum loss, restoring from backup, and troubleshooting node join issues.

- [Automate SQL Server Backups with PowerShell](https://datacrazyworld.com/index.php/2025/03/16/automatiza-backups-de-sql-server-con-powershell/) - This article provides a PowerShell script to automate SQL Server backups. It outlines the script's functionality, including generating backups for specified databases, prioritizing larger ones, and moving the backup files to a designated folder. Key configuration elements like SQL Server IP and instance name, user credentials, excluded databases, and log file path are detailed.
